Common Issues with Aluminium French Doors
Before diving into the repair procedure, it is necessary to comprehend a few of the common issues that can take place with aluminium French doors:
IssueDescriptionPossible CauseMisalignmentDoors do not close appropriately and might stick or drag.Damaged hinges, settling of the structure.Leakages and draftsAir or water infiltrates through the doors.Used seals, damaged weather condition removing.Damaged locksLocks become inoperative, preventing safe closure.Wear with time, corrosion, or unexpected damage.Scratches or damagesSurface imperfections that affect visual appeals.Unexpected effects or abrasive cleansing.CondensationMoisture accumulation between the glass panes.Sealed system failure (IGU) or bad installation.Tools and Materials Required for Repairs

Step-by-Step Guide:
Check Alignment: Close the door and observe any gaps. Utilize a level to ensure the frame is plumb.Adjust Hinges: Loosen the screws on the hinges slightly and adjust as required. Tighten up screws when aligned.Check the Frame: If the frame has actually settled, consider utilizing shims to adjust it effectively.2. Leaks and Drafts
Step-by-Step Guide:
Inspect Weather Stripping: Look for worn or broken weather condition removing. Remove it and determine for replacement.Use New Weather Stripping: Cut the brand-new material to size and attach it in the very same place.Seal Gaps: Use caulk to fill any other gaps in between the frame and the wall.3. Broken Locks
Step-by-Step Guide:
Remove Lock Cylinder: Unscrew the faceplate and pull out the lock cylinder.Replace: Insert the brand-new lock cylinder and secure it with screws.Test Functionality: Ensure all parts are working properly before closing the door.4. Scratches and Dents
Step-by-Step Guide:
Clean the Area: Use a gentle cleaner to remove dirt around the scratched area.Utilize a Touch-Up Kit: Apply paint or aluminum-specific touch-up products to hide imperfections.Polish: Finally, clear any residue later and polish the surface.5. Dealing with Condensation
Step-by-Step Guide:
Inspect the Sealed Unit: Check for raised seals or fogging in between the glass.Contact Professionals: Condensation typically requires professional intervention to replace the glass unit.Consider Replacement Options: Evaluate energy-efficient glass options during replacement.Preventive Maintenance Tips

How frequently should I perform maintenance on my aluminium French doors?
Maintenance needs to be done every six months or as required, depending upon climate condition and use.
Q2. Can I replace parts of my aluminium French doors myself?
Yes, lots of minor repairs such as altering locks or weather condition stripping can be done by house owners with basic tools. Nevertheless, bigger issues may need professional aid.
Q3. Is it better to repair or replace broken aluminium French doors?
This depends upon the level of the damage. Small repairs are usually more cost-effective, while substantial structural issues or serious damage might necessitate a complete replacement.
Q4. How do I eliminate scratches from aluminium French doors?
While minor scratches can be covered with touch-up paint, deep ones might need professional attention or replacement of impacted panels.
Q5. What type of weather stripping is best for aluminium doors?
Foam or rubber weather condition removing is most common and efficient for aluminium French doors, offering a good seal versus drafts.
